This routine, announced inspection reviewed the implementation of the radiological l environmental monitoring and the meteorological monitoring programs. Training and 1 qualifications, quality assurance oversight, facilities and equipment, and annual reports were j

- also reviewed, i

Plant Support

,

.

Overall, an effective radiological environmental monitoring program was implemente Sample collection, shipment, and analyses were properly performed. Air sampler 'l operability was 98.8 percent throughout 1997 (Section R1,1 and R2.1). ]

l

.

Overall, an effective meteorological program was in place. The meteorological I monitoring equipment was maintained in excellent operating condition. Housekeeping of all observed areas was very good. Meteorological data recovery in 1997 was 98 percent.(Sections R1.2 and R2.2).

. The licensee did not perform a comprehensive independent assessment as part of the 1997 annual quality assurance audit of the radiological environmental monitoring program. The audit utilized the results of an NRC inspection report to satisfy  ;

approximately 90 percent of the programmatic elements listed in the audit plan (Section R7.1).

' Inspection Scope (847EO)

The radiological environmental monitoring program was reviewed to determine compliance with Technical Specifications, Technical Requirements Manual, and Offsite l Dose Calculation Manual requirements. Selected environmental sampling stations were j inspecte i i Observations and Findinas inspection of air and vegetation sample stations verified that the stations were maintained as described in the Offsite Dose Calculation Manual. The inspector accompanied and observed a health physicist collect and prepare for shipment particulate and charcoal cartridge air samples. These activities were conducted in accordance with approved procedures. The inspector noted that the collection of air sample media was performed by replacing the sampler heads in the field minimizing the potential for cross contamination and preserving sample integrity. A review of the sample collection logs, sample shipment forms, and sample analyses reports revealed the these documents were properly maintaine The inspector determined that collection frequency, processing, and analyses of the radiological environmental samples were performed in accordance with the Offsite Dose Calculation Manual.' The 1997 annualland use census was properly periormed, and the land use census results were documented as required in the appropriate annual radiological environmental operating report. A co...,.,rehensive radiological environmental monitoring report for 1997 was submitted in a timely manner. Review of 1997 environmental biota, river water, and groundwater sample results indicated that the operation of Grand Gulf Nuclear Station resulted in no detectable buildup of radioactivity in the environment, and thermoluminescent dosimeter results indicated that plant  !

operations did not affect the ambient radiation levels in the environmen !

All environmental samples were analyzed at the Entergy Operations corporate environmentallaboratory located at River Bend Nuclear Station. The corporate l environmental laboratory participated in an interlaboratory comparison program as required by the Technical Requirements Manual. The inspector venfied that analytical c results from the interlaboratory comparison program satisfied performance criteria and l were properly reported in the annual radiological environmental operating report ;

The 1997 radiological environmental operating report was comprehensive and submitted in a timely manne R1.2 Meteoroloaical Monitorina Proaram Inspection Scope (84750)

The meteorological monitoring program was reviewed to determine agreement with j commitments in the Updated Final Safety Analysis Report and the recommendations in NRC Regulatory Guide 1.23. The inspector reviewed data collection and data displays i at station facilitie I 1 Observations and Findinas The inspector noted that the meteorological tower's primary and secondary instrumentation and configuration agreed with the guidance in Regulatory Guide 1.23 and commitments in the Updated Final Safety Analysis Report. The primary tower i provided for meteorological instrument redundancy at the 33- and 162 foot levels. The inspector was informed that the primary tower utilized three separate power supplies to ensure power was continuously maintaine .

The inspector verified that appropriate meteorological data was transmitted and displayed in the station's emergency facilities and the control room. The system engineer stated that meteorological data was connected to the site-wide computer system so that all computers connected to that system had access to the meteorological dat The 1997 meteorological data recovery for wind direction, wind speed, temperature, and delta temperature instruments was 98 percent indicating that overall a very effective meteorological program was in plac Conclusions Overall, an effective meteorological program was in place. The performance of the meteorological monitoring program agreed with the guidance contained in Regulatory Guide 1.23 and commitments in the Updated Final Safety Analysis Repor Meteorological data recovery in 1997 was 98 percent.

The inspector reviewed Audit 12.01-97 which was performed to satisfy the quality assurance annual requirement for auditing the radiological environmental monitoring program in 1997. The inspector noted the cover page of the audit stated,"Because of a recent inspection performed by the NRC, not all of the audit plan items were performed this audit." in addition, the Audit Scope / Summary section of the audit stated," Credit was taken for some aspects of the audit based upon an inspection done by the NRC in June 1997."

The inspector noted that independent licensee audit activities only covered a small fraction of the radiological environmental monitoring program. Specifically, the audit only addressed an evaluation of the interlaboratory and intralaboratory comparison programs required to be implemented by the vendor responsible for analysis of the environmental media samples and a section addressing follow-up on recommendations from the previous audi The inspector reviewed the audit plan, which identified the elements to be evaluated in the radiological environmental monitoring program, and noted that over 90 percent of the elements were marked 'N/A" (not applicable) with a statement that the activity was ;

already reviewed by the NRC. In discussion with the Acting Quality Audits Supervisor, ;

tr'e inspector was informed that the NRC inspection report was not a substitution for a !

ILensee audit, but to indicate that an evaluation of the NRC inspection report and depth )

of the inspection performed was conducted and used as a basis for not looking at a l particular element or elements contained in the audit plan. The licensee also stated that j the NRC inspection of the radiological environmental monitoring program in 1997 was 1 more thorough than usual allowing them to justify reducing the scope of their audi The inspector commented that the use of an NRC inspection report is an acceptable performance reference; however, to rely on an NRC inspection report to reduce the scope of a required annual audit plan by approximately 90 percent is not a good replacement for a comprehensive independent assessmen !

.

,

,

i r

- i-9-  ;

The licensee's audit program was discussed with the Office of Nuclear Reactor Regulation. It was agreed that the use of an NRC inspection report was not a good replacement for a licensee audit. However, no violations of regulatory requirements ;

were identifie j Conclusions The licensee did not perform a comprehensive independent assessment as part of the f 1997 annual quality assurance audit of the radiological environmental program. The audit utilized the results of a previous NRC inspection report to satisfy approximately 90 percent of the programmatic elements listed in the audit pla R7.2 Condition Reports and Corrective Actions l Inspection Scope (84750) j i
